Jackson Police Officer Involved Shooting on Littleberry Cove

Officer Involved Shooting on Littleberry Cove Police were called to investigate a threatening phone call that was made to what turned out to be a wrong number. The female caller made threats to kill a local member of the judiciary and their family. Investigators traced the call to a cellular phone belonging to Steva Williams age 40 who resides in an apartment in the 900 block Old Hickory Blvd. The Officers who went to Ms. Williams apartment report they found Ms. Williams to be highly agitated. Reportedly, she responded to Investigators but her responses were disconnected to the questions asked and at times she was almost incoherent. Based on the nature of the threats and the Officers observations it was apparent that Ms. Williams was a potential threat to herself and others and needed to be transported to the hospital for evaluation and any appropriate treatment. When Officers explained to Ms. Williams what they were about to do, she ran from the room and into the kitchen where she armed herself with a large knife. Before Officers could detain and disarm her she fled out the back door. Officers called for assistance and reported the now armed and apparently unbalanced Williams running into a residential area behind the apartments. Officer located and confronted Ms. Williams on Littleberry Cove. Based on the preliminary investigation and witness interviews, when Officers attempted to stop Ms. Williams she went toward one of the Officers with the knife even though he was ordering her to stop. He struck her with his baton but she didn’t stop. The Officer shot her at close range as she continued to come on him. Ms. Williams was transported by ambulance and was conscious when they left the scene. At this writing, 6:00 p.m. Sunday, Ms. Williams is undergoing emergency surgery. She is under guard charged with aggravated assault on an Officer. She may face additional charges connected with the threats The Officer who shot Ms. Williams is not injured. He is on paid administrative leave, which is normal procedure when an Officer is involved in a shooting. The investigation is ongoing.
